Dream Hotel Group announces the appointment of Vaughn Pierre Davis as general manager of Dream Hollywood. Davis launched his hospitality career nearly a decade ago in New York City where he began as a guest attendant at Gansevoort Meatpacking. From there, he served as the director of guest services at Dream Downtown for four years before taking on a prominent hotel management position with Joie de Vivre to launch its very first hotel in New York City at 50 Bowery.

Davis saw great opportunity with Dream Hollywood's luxurious room product, stellar service and renowned food and beverage operators, prompting his recent move from New York City to Los Angeles to join the team just in time for summer, as the hotel celebrates its two-year anniversary.

A specialized lifestyle hotel operator with experience in results-driven partnerships and programming, Davis is credited with creating the first Sneaker Concierge program at Dream Downtown's GuestHouse Suite. This program created an experience where guests received a pair of sneakers curated uniquely for them by resident 'Sneakerologist,' Davis himself. Seeing firsthand the interest, demand and story-telling opportunities this impactful partnership attracted, during his time at 50 Bowery Davis he spearheaded equally successful partnerships with brands including WHITE FOX Electric Scooters, food delivery service Caviar and Uber.

Since arriving at Dream Hollywood, Davis has hit the ground running and is currently developing similar programs to elevate the guest experience. From activating the pool and public spaces, to introducing partnerships in the tech, wellness and culinary fields, Davis' vision will further establish the hotel as a hub for both locals and guests in Hollywood.

Coming from an international background, Davis grew up in Georgetown, Guyana and, later, Queens, New York. Currently, he resides in his new city of Los Angeles with his wife, Ashley, and four children, Vaughn, Kylie, Hallie and Ellie.
